"Undecided" Leading In KC Star Primary Poll

January 28, 2004 By admin Leave a Comment

The Kansas City Star has run a quick poll after the New Hampshire primary, and “undecided” has a big lead. The poll is co-sponsored by KMBC-Television in Kansas City. It asked the opinions of likely voters in next Tuesday’s primary. 35 percent of those responding are undecided. Of those who say they have made up their minds, John Kerry gets 25 percent. John Edwards runs second with 9 percent support. Howard Dean has six percent. Then it’s Lieberman, Kucinich, and Sharpton.
